Back End Engineer

Codekeeper
Summary
Join Codekeeper's team as a Back End Engineer specializing in Ruby Stack and contribute to the development of new features for our groundbreaking app. You will be involved in the full software development lifecycle, from concept to deployment, focusing on creating and maintaining scalable, high-quality applications. This role requires proficiency in Ruby, Python, or Node.js, expertise in Ruby on Rails, and familiarity with AWS. The ideal candidate is proactive, thrives in fast-paced environments, and possesses excellent communication skills. Codekeeper offers a remote-first work environment, a supportive team, and ample opportunities for growth. We are looking for a passionate and skilled individual to join our team and help us revolutionize software escrow for the cloud era.
Requirements
- Proficiency in Ruby, Python, or Node.js
- Expertise in Ruby on Rails
- Familiarity with AWS
- A good sense of React
- Passion for building beautiful, intuitive interfaces and scalable backends
- Driven and enthusiastic personality
- Excellent communication skills in English
- Ability to adapt and multitask in a fast-paced environment
Responsibilities
- Collaborate with our team on the development of our app and drive new feature development
- Utilize a Ruby-on-Rails and React stack, hosted on AWS
- Write well-structured, lightweight, and easily editable code, supported by testing
- Follow our clearly defined product development process and detailed interaction designs
- Exercise a high degree of autonomy in deciding the best solutions for tasks and discussing implementation decisions during code reviews
Benefits
- Passionate and fun-loving colleagues
- Startup mindset with ample opportunities for growth
- Regular team activities and gatherings
- Comprehensive onboarding process with a dedicated ramp-up period
- A supportive team that values open communication and direct feedback
- A chance to excel in your career and make a difference